Flags to be lowered in respect of the dead at Virginia Tech

Washington, Apr 17 (UNI) President Bush has ordered all flags in the country would beflown at half mast in the honour of those killed in the nation's deadliest campus shooting spree in Virginia Tech.

The President also planned to speak later today at the institution, where 33 people were gunned down in two separate attacks. He and First Lady Laura Bush will attend a campus convocation "as representatives of the entire nation," according to spokesperson Dana Perino.

''They will be there as the national representatives on a day that is full of sorrow for every American,'' she said. ''He will remark about the amazing strength of the community, and I'm not just talking about the city limits of Blacksburg, but as you have seen that there's been an outpouring of support.'' The Ppresident and the First Lady will be there in the hope lending support to those who had lost their near and dear ones and also to help the university begin the healing process following the tragedy. He will speak for roughly five minutes.

"They are going to be there to express the sympathies, the support and the prayers of the country," Ms Perino said this morning.

Mr Bush is also likely to give television interviews on campus before returning to the White House.

Meanwhile Virginia Governor Timothy M Kaine, who cut short his trip to Japan to deal with the tragedy, was traveling with the President on Air Force One to the convocation.
